Output e7a80c6d077d0c2259227d15ce478f31d912d179f981c3bb26cc61f32f1f30d6:1

value
138837639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 381daf993e21ce9b1b0b17e3958776ed12d417a6 OP_EQUAL
address
36ojKuD8uF3kzxie5Jij1GMjxDrEdzDE6L
transaction
e7a80c6d077d0c2259227d15ce478f31d912d179f981c3bb26cc61f32f1f30d6
spent
true